I know win 95 is old-hat now, but Im trying to help a friend with a problem.

Every time they boot up their PC (A Gateway G5-200 <shudder>) the Standard IDE/ESCD Hard Disk Controller in Device Manager keeps being lost, and you get a little yellow "!" over it. If you click Properties > Update Driver and select standard driver it installs and the CD is then recognised and works properly...

However as soon as you reboot, it's lost it again and you have to repeat the procedure!!!

Boot your machine into safe mode and delete all devices from "device manager". Then boot up normally and let windows to set up everything form beginning. BTW, typical problem with Win9x crappy hardware management 🙂
